Implementation

@override
Future<List<EagleSourceEntry>> list(EaglePath directory) async {
  try {
    final candidate = _lexical(directory);
    final type = await FileSystemEntity.type(candidate, followLinks: false);
    if (type == FileSystemEntityType.notFound) {
      throw EagleSourceException('Directory does not exist: $directory');
    }
    final resolved = await _resolvedContained(candidate, type);
    final entries = <EagleSourceEntry>[];
    await for (final entity in Directory(resolved).list(followLinks: false)) {
      final entityType = await FileSystemEntity.type(
        entity.path,
        followLinks: false,
      );
      final targetType = entityType == FileSystemEntityType.link
          ? await FileSystemEntity.type(entity.path)
          : entityType;
      await _resolvedContained(entity.path, entityType);
      if (targetType != FileSystemEntityType.file &&
          targetType != FileSystemEntityType.directory) {
        continue;
      }
      final name = p.basename(entity.path);
      final path = directory.isRoot
          ? EaglePath.parse(name)
          : directory.child(name);
      entries.add(
        EagleSourceEntry(
          name: name,
          path: path,
          kind: targetType == FileSystemEntityType.directory
              ? EagleSourceEntryKind.directory
              : EagleSourceEntryKind.file,
        ),
      );
    }
    entries.sort((left, right) => left.name.compareTo(right.name));
    return List<EagleSourceEntry>.unmodifiable(entries);
  } on EagleSourceException {
    rethrow;
  } catch (error) {
    throw EagleSourceException('Directory cannot be listed.', cause: error);
  }
}
